Facts or opinions?

Ungdomstrinnet

Mål: Å hjelpe elevene å bevisstgjøre seg begrepene fakter og personlige meninger og hvordan de uttrykkes på engelsk.

Materiell: Skrivesaker.

Task 1.

Copy the sentences below. Underline facts in blue and opinions in red.

The car was blue.

The man had lost his coat.

“Friends” is not a very good television programme.

Some people mean that Manchester United is the best football club in the world.

I believe that he will win the race.

Pete Sampras is the best tennis player in the world.

Pete Sampras, the tennis player, won the World Championships.

We think Mark stole the car.

In my opinion we have the best food in the world here in Norway e.g. fish balls and potato cakes.

The church is the tallest building in our town.

Task 2.

Work in pairs and give reasons for your answers in task 1.

Task 3.

Use sentences and write

two facts about a pop group.

two opinions about a pop group.

two facts about school.

two opinions about school.

two facts about food.

two opinions about food.

Task 4.

Copy the following passages into your book. Underline in blue sentences that you think present facts. Underline opinions in red.

“This is the most exciting game of football that I have ever seen. David Beckham is the best player on the pitch. He has scored five goals in this match. I think he will score even more goals today!”

“Tomorrow is an important day for the pop group BoysRUs. They release their third CD tomorrow. Their last two CDs have gone straight into the charts at number 1. This new CD is an awful mix of pop and blues music. It is not as good as their earlier CDs.”

“Buy the new Superclean bathroom cleaner. Use Superclean only once and your bathroom will never have been so clean! Superclean is made of a mixture of soap and bleach. Only £1.99 a bottle”

Task 5.

Write a newspaper article. You can choose what you write about. Include facts and opinions. Underline sentences that present facts in blue. Underline sentences that present opinions in red.
